The Novation Launchkey 49 [MK3] boasts an impressive set of features designed to enhance your music production experience. Its Chord Mode allows musicians to trigger full chords with a single note, providing both ease and creative freedom when composing harmonies. The Scale Mode ensures every note you play is in key, eliminating mistakes and helping you stay focused on your performance. Additionally, the Arpeggiator feature can transform simple chords into dynamic, complex patterns, adding depth and movement to your compositions.

Another key advantage of the Launchkey 49 [MK3] is its seamless integration with Ableton Live, offering a streamlined workflow that is both efficient and inspiring. The keyboard’s color-coded pads and intuitive layout make it easy to navigate through various functions, allowing you to focus on your music without unnecessary distractions. Furthermore, its lightweight and compact design makes it perfect for musicians on the go, ensuring that inspiration can strike anywhere and anytime.

The MPK Mini MK3 offers an impressive range of features packed into a compact design. Its 25 keys are velocity-sensitive, allowing for expressive performances, while the 8 backlit drum pads provide a satisfying tactile response, perfect for crafting beats and triggering samples. The 8 assignable knobs give users the ability to manipulate sounds and effects with precision, making it an ideal choice for producers who value control and flexibility in their music-making process. Additionally, the inclusion of music production software and NKS Integration enhances its value, providing users with a complete package to start producing music right out of the box.

Beyond its functional features, the Akai Professional MPK Mini MK3 is designed with the user in mind, offering a user-friendly interface that simplifies the music creation process. Its lightweight build ensures that it can be easily transported, making it a perfect companion for live performances or on-the-go production sessions. Although it has a limited key range, the MPK Mini MK3 compensates with its diverse capabilities and integration with popular music software, making it a versatile tool for anyone looking to expand their creative horizons in the world of music production.
